Book Summary:
Don’t Polish Your Ignorance… It May Shine by Sadhguru is a thought-provoking collection of insights and teachings that challenge readers to look beyond superficial knowledge and truly seek inner understanding. Through his signature blend of wit, clarity, and spiritual depth, Sadhguru explores how people often mistake information and belief for true wisdom. He encourages readers to move from intellectual arrogance to genuine awareness by questioning assumptions and experiencing life directly. The book covers a range of themes—self-realization, consciousness, spirituality, and the limitations of modern thinking—while urging readers to discover truth through inner exploration rather than borrowed ideas. Simple yet profound, this book serves as a guide to breaking free from illusion and awakening to the deeper realities of existence.
About the Author:
Sadhguru (Jaggi Vasudev) is an Indian yogi, mystic, and spiritual teacher known for his practical approach to spirituality and self-transformation. He is the founder of the Isha Foundation, a non-profit organization that offers yoga programs and social outreach initiatives worldwide. Born on September 3, 1957, in Mysuru, India, Sadhguru has dedicated his life to helping people achieve balance, clarity, and inner well-being through yoga and meditation. He is also a bestselling author and influential speaker, addressing global audiences on topics such as consciousness, environment, and human potential. Through his books, teachings, and projects, Sadhguru continues to inspire millions to live more consciously and harmoniously.
